Conceptual Cost Estimates

Conceptual construction and operating cost estimates are critical in evaluating project viability. By preparing cost estimates early in the project, key decisions can be made before significant design work has commenced. Cost estimates prepared at the ±35% accuracy level allow for quick screening of process alternatives and assist in determining if a project meets established financial goals.


Plant Commissioning Assistance

Before transitioning a plant into commercial operation, full commissioning is key to ensure equipment, control systems and safety-related devices have been properly tested.
